calumenin; crocalbin; IEF SSP 9302 (CALU)
Function:
- role in regulation of vitamin K-dependent carboxylation of multiple amino-terminal glutamate residues
- seems to inhibit gamma-carboxylase GGCX
- binds 7 Ca+2 with a low affinity (putative)
- interacts with GGCX (putative)
Structure:
- belongs to the CREC family
- contains 6 EF-hand domains
Compartment:
- endoplasmic reticulum lumen
- secreted
- melanosome: stages 1-4
- sarcoplasmic reticulum lumen (putative)
Alternative splicing: named isoforms=2
Expression:
- ubiquitously expressed
- expressed at high levels in heart, placenta & skeletal muscle
- expressed at lower levels in lung, kidney & pancreas
- expressed at very low levels in brain & liver
